1. Always start with goals
Effort without a genuine purpose is just effort. Effective people don't just know what to do; they also know why.
- Have a long-term goal
- Have short term goals to support your long-term goals
You'll find it easy to stay focused and be effective.

2. Create systems
A goal is great for planning and mapping out what success looks like; a system is great for actually making progress towards the goal.
Extremely well-organised people know a goal can provide direction.

3. Believe in yourself
Hard work is hard. Pushing forward when successes are few and the road is long, takes optimism and self-belief.
That's why busy people quickly give up and effective people keep going.

4. Use your goals to make decisions automatic
If you feel like you're constantly struggling to make decisions, take a step back.
Think about your goals, and make decisions accordingly.
When you know what you truly want, most of your decisions can and should be instinctive.

5. Don't multitask
Try to do two things at once and you'll do both half-assed.
Focus on one thing at a time. Do that thing incredibly well, and then move on to whatever is next.
